The best method I have found for relating mathematical and scientific concepts to students has been with a majority of examples. While explaining theory is necessary for a student to gain the basics of a concept it is only through working problems and exercises that a student truly understands the material. When teaching I would usually explain a section of material as best I could, then work through multiple examples that illustrate the material. This is then supplemented with exercises for the students to work through on their own.
